Bill Summary
To amend the Small Business Act to ensure that the Commonwealth of the Northern Mariana Islands is eligible for certain Small Business Administration programs, and for other purposes. This bill expands eligibility for certain Small Business Administration programs to the Commonwealth of the Northern Mariana Islands.
AI Summary
This bill expands eligibility for certain Small Business Administration (SBA) programs to the Commonwealth of the Northern Mariana Islands. Specifically, it amends the Small Business Act to ensure that the Northern Mariana Islands can access the Microloan program, Small Business Development Centers, and the Federal and State Technology Partnership Program, which were previously limited to other U.S. territories like American Samoa. This change aims to provide the Northern Mariana Islands with greater access to SBA resources and support for small businesses in the region.
